Structural foundation repair services focus on identifying and resolving issues related to the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ically involve thorough assessments to determine the extent of foundation problems, followed by targeted repair techniques such as underpinning, piering, or stabilization. The goal is to restore the foundation’s strength, prevent further damage, and ensure the safety and functionality of the property. Repair specialists employ a variety of methods tailored to the specific conditions of each property to address issues effectively.

Foundation problems can manifest in several ways, including vis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ping surfaces, and doors or windows that no longer open or close properly. These symptoms often indicate shifting or settling of the foundation, which can be caused by so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or construction practices. Addressing these issues promptly with professional foundation repair services can help prevent more severe structural damage, such as wall bowing, interior cracks, or even collapse in extreme cases.

Properties that commonly require foundation repair services include residential homes, especially older structures, as well as commercial buildings and multi-family complexes. Homes built on expansive clay soils or in areas prone to moisture changes are particularly susceptible to foundation shifting. Commercial properties with large or heavy structures may also need foundation stabilization to maintain safety and operational integrity. Regardless of property type, ensuring a solid foundation is essential for long-term durability and safety.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for foundation repair services ranges from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age and repair methods used. For example, minor cracks might cost around $2,000, while more extensive underpinning could reach $7,000 or more.

Material and Method Variations - Costs vary based on the repair approach, such as piering or slabjacking, which can influence prices. Piering might cost between $3,000 and $10,000, while slabjacking generally falls between $2,500 and $6,000.

Property Size and Severity - Larger properties or those with significant foundation issues tend to incur higher repair costs. Repairs for a small home may start around $2,000, whereas larger or more severely damaged foundations could exceed $10,000.

Additional Expenses - Additional costs may include permits, excavation, or reinforcement, which can add several thousand dollars to the overall price.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to specific foundation con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around doorframes or moldings.

How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method, but most projects can be completed within a few days to a week.

Are foundation repairs disruptive to daily life? Repair processes may involve some noise, dust, or minor disruptions, but experienced service providers aim to minimize inconvenience during the work.

What causes foundation issues in homes? Common causes include soil settlement, moisture changes, poor drainage, tree roots, and fluctuations in groundwater levels.
